Course Content

• Digital Ethnography & Netnography: Methods for studying online communities and cultures.
• Algorithmic Culture & Social Media: Analyzing the impact of algorithms on social interactions and behaviors.
• Data Visualization & Social Network Analysis: Visualizing and interpreting social data using network analysis techniques.
• Big Data & Digital Sociology: Exploring the ethical and methodological challenges of analyzing massive datasets.
• The Politics of Online Platforms: Examining power dynamics, censorship, and misinformation on digital platforms.
• Digital Inequality & Access: Understanding the social and economic disparities in digital access and participation.
• Online Identity & Self-Presentation: Exploring how individuals construct and manage their identities in online spaces.
• Digital Methods in Social Research: A practical guide to conducting research using digital tools and techniques.
